Waffles:
Ingredients
1 cup all-purpose flour, spooned and leveled
2 tablespoons sugar
1 teaspoon baking pow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 cup milk
2 large eggs
4 tablespoons (1/2 stick) unsalted butter, melted
Maple syrup and butter, as desired, for serving
Directions
1. Preheat waffle iron according to manufacturer's instructions. In a large bowl, whisk fl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t; set aside.
2. In a small bowl, whisk milk and eggs; pour over flour mixture, and whisk gently to combine (don't overmix). Gently whisk in butter.
3. Following manufacturer's instructions, cook waffles until deep brown and crisp. (For a standard waffle iron, pour a generous 1/2 cup of batter into center, spreading to within 1/2 inch of edges, and close; waffle will cook in 2 to 3 minutes.) Serve warm, with maple syrup and butter, as desired.
Fried Chicken:
1 pound chicken fillets
1 cup panko crumbs
1/4 cup milk
1 egg
Preheat oven to 425F. Place rack in top third of oven.
Prepare two bowls: one with panko crumbs and one with the egg and milk (whisk the egg & milk together).
Dip each piece of chicken one by one into the liquid bowl (let excess drip off) and then the panko. Place on a non-stick baking sheet.
Bake for 15-20 minutes or until they're cooked through.
Blueberry Habanero Maple Syrup
Purple Blaze Hot Sauce
Maple Syrup
Add Purple Blaze Hot Sauce to Maple Syrup about 1 : 1 ratio
